Draycott-based FC Laser (
www.fclaser.co.uk), a rapidly expanding precision laser cutting specialist, achieved a monthly turnover of £500,000 in November.
This follows the recent announcements of the company’s sales growing by 30% over 12 months and customer activity increasing by 20% in a single month.
As a result of this increased turnover and activity, the company — founded in 2012 — has moved to a larger (20,000ft
2) and more eco-friendly facility and is looking to recruit nine more members of staff.
FC Laser has the very latest laser cutting technology, having recently extended its suite of Bystronic laser centres by the addition of three 10kW fibre machines with the latest ByTrans material loading and unloading system.
